JAMSHEDPUR – Motilal Nehru Public School organized a chocolate making workshop to empower mothers with entrepreneurial skills.
Principal Sangeeta Singh addressed the participants. “This initiative aims to promote self-reliance,” a school official noted.
Skill Development
Vice Principal Bindu Ahuja led the training. She demonstrated chocolate making techniques.
Meanwhile, participants learned packaging methods. The workshop focused on practical applications.
Moreover, the school promises future opportunities. Participants will get platforms to showcase their skills.
Interactive Learning
The event featured engaging activities. A quiz competition added excitement to learning.
Furthermore, winners received special hampers. Principal Singh personally presented the prizes.
